Sponsor's own description
Osteoarthritis (OA) is a joint disorder that often occurs and causes disability. This disorder is characterized by an inflammatory reaction in the synovial joints accompanied by a gradual degeneration process in the articular cartilage and sub-chondral bone. Current research has discovered that stem cells produce conditioned media (secretome, extra vesicles, and exosomes) that have tissue regeneration, immunomodulation, anti-inflammatory, and anti-apoptotic capabilities. Research on conditioned media for umbilical cord mesenchymal stem cells is still at the in vivo stage in experimental animals. For this reason, this study aims to conduct clinical experimental research (translational study) in patients with knee joint OA who were given umbilical cord mesenchymal stem cell conditioned media via intra-articular injection.
